Annette Olson commented on an older version of "Egyptian Mongoose":
Although there is some good info in here, some of it comes from a popular site that takes its info from other popular sites, etc., and some problems have crept in. Mating is often April-May, the species is thought to occur in Namibia according to IUCN, and it is usually found in males overlapping home ranges with females, not in groups. Also, the listing of forests versus implies it prefers forests, when actually it prefers scrubland and grassland (though found in forests.) One of the references also is no longer online.
